Homes & Architecture
In Scottsville, you’ll find a mix of traditional single-family homes, charming bungalows, and a few newer builds that respect the area’s established character. Many homes feature classic Kentucky architecture—think front porches, gabled roofs, and mature trees shading the yard. You’ll see everything from early 20th-century farmhouses with original details to more modern ranch-style layouts. Larger lots are common, giving homeowners plenty of outdoor space for gardens, gatherings, or just enjoying the quiet. Interiors tend to favor practical, comfortable layouts, with open kitchens and living spaces designed for real, everyday living.

What types of homes are common in Scottsville?
In Scottsville, you'll mostly find single-family homes, along with some townhomes and older properties with character. There are also a few homes on larger lots or acreage, appealing to those who want more space. New construction pops up occasionally, but classic homes are more typical.
